Operation scheme of child care institutions

Operation scheme of child care institutions

With the increasing number of dual-income families, the demand for child care services is also increasing. As a special institution providing child care services, child care institutions have gradually become the choice of most families. The operation scheme of child care institutions is very important for them to effectively carry out their services. The operation scheme of the nursing institution will be described below.

1. Service content

Nursery aims to provide professional, safe and comfortable child care services for double-income families. Therefore, we should take this as the purpose when formulating the service content, and formulate the service content suitable for children of different ages according to their various needs.

2. Business hours

The business hours of kindergartens are closely related to whether they can serve as many families as possible. Generally speaking, the working hours of most dual-employee families are around 9:00- 17:00 or 8:00- 18:00. Therefore, nursery institutions should provide nursery services within this time range to facilitate as many families as possible.

3. Quality of service

Service quality is the core competitiveness of nursery institutions, and it is also one of the important factors for parents to choose nursery institutions. While providing child care services, child care institutions should try their best to ensure the quality of services, formulate service norms that meet standards, standardize service processes and improve service quality.

4. Safety and security

As a client of child care institutions, the safety of children is the most important. Nursery institutions should operate legally, strictly abide by relevant regulations and standards, have fire control and safety measures, establish and improve safety management systems, and ensure the safety of children.

5. Personnel quality

The service quality and safety level of child care institutions largely depend on the quality of service personnel. Therefore, nursery institutions should carefully select nursery service personnel, who should meet the relevant qualification certificates, have experience in nursery service, have a certain academic background and psychological foundation, and have the qualities of patience, carefulness, responsibility and love.

6. Facilities and equipment

The facilities and equipment of child care institutions aim to provide a safe and comfortable child care environment for children and promote their all-round and healthy development. Therefore, kindergartens should strictly control the selection of facilities and equipment to ensure that they meet the standards, and establish a sound maintenance system for facilities and equipment to ensure the safety and stability of children's use of facilities and equipment.

7. Charge standard

When setting the charging standards, child care institutions should comprehensively consider the service content, service quality, service time, service area and other aspects to ensure that the fees are reasonable, and the fees should be similar to those of other child care institutions in the same industry in order to win market competition.

8. Parent-child interaction activities

In addition to providing child care services, child care institutions should also strengthen the interaction between families and institutions through parent-child interaction activities, provide more support and help to parents, so that parents can give their children to the institutions with more confidence and peace of mind, and at the same time improve the visibility and reputation of the institutions.
